South Tyneside International Magic Festival, full convention line-up revealed. The final line-up for one of the UK’s most popular magic conventions has now been revealed, with just three weeks remaining to the big event. The convention at the South Tyneside International Magic Festival, which celebrates its 10th anniversary this year, will be returning to South Shields, South Tyneside from Friday, March 8th to Sunday, March 10th. Day one will include a children’s show and lecture with Jimmy Carlo, a workshop with voice coach Simon Raybould, close-up sessions with Dani DaOrtiz, Charlie Frye, Rob James, Sylvester the Jester and Gaston and the choice of either a séance lecture by Dale Shrimpton or a question and answer session with Debbie McGee. It will end with an International Gala Show featuring a host of stars, including Paul Daniels and renowned puppeteer Scott Land, followed by an exclusive midnight performance by comedy spirit medium Ian D Montford, who recently began hosting his own show on BBC Radio 2. Day two will include lectures by Charlie Frye, Graham P Jolley, living cartoon Sylvester the Jester, Gaston, Brian Sefton and John Archer, with John also set to host another International Gala Show featuring performers from around the world. The convention will close on Sunday with lectures by Pete Turner and Scott Land and the opportunity for attendees to take part in a master class with Scott, Sylvester the Jester or Dani DaOrtiz. For those who arrive early an additional master class will be available with Pete Turner on Thursday, March 7th. All four days will also offer the opportunity for attendees to meet with various magic dealers from across the UK. Tickets for the convention, priced at £65, include entry to both Gala Shows, the Midnight show and all lectures and close-up sessions. Masterclasses incur an additional charge. The Secret World of Charles Dickens, mirth, marvels and the mysterious. Ian Keable, winner of The Magic Circle Comedy Award, performs the favourite magic tricks of Charles Dickens and divulges the spooky practices of Victorian psychics. Charles Dickens, in addition to being one of the world’s greatest writers, was an expert conjurer. He was also sceptical about spiritualism, which was a popular pastime in the 1800s. This humorous and mystifying show recreates, in the authentic parlour room atmosphere of the 16th century Lauderdale House, how Dickens deceived his audiences and why, to quote a famous contemporary, Elizabeth Browning, he was “fond of Ghost stories so long as they were impossible.” Venue: Lauderdale House, Waterlow Park, Highgate Hill, London N6 5HG (Map). Two international lectures at the British Magical Society, Birmingham, this week. Paul Cadley writes: The British Magical Society, in Birmingham, are proud to present not one, but two star lecturers this week. Firstly, on Tuesday 26th February – Dirk Losander. In the world of magic the name Losander is synonymous with the art of levitation. Losander has performed his magic in exclusive venues from Europe to Japan and Australia. He has performed in the internationally famed Magic Castle in Hollywood and is currently performing in the World’s Greatest Magic Show in Las Vegas. In 2006, Losander received the Milbourne Christopher Award for Illusionist of the Year and notable contributions to the art of magic. 7.30pm on Tuesday 26th February at Selly Oak Ex Serviceman’s Club, Selly Oak, Birmingham B29 7DL (Map). Non-members are invited to attend for a modest £5 fee. See www.britishmagicalsociety.co.uk for details. Then on Thursday 28th February, Marcelo Insua (Mr Tango) makes his only appearance in the Midlands. Winner of the 2012 FISM World Magic Championship Invention Award, and world renowned for his range of coin effects, there is so much more to Mr Tango. A Professional Magician for over 20 Years, his lecture features coins, cards and mentalism with material honed in his own Magic Bar, but well within the capability of all. Owen Lean lectures at The Surrey Society of Magicians on 28th February. Adam Mosley writes: "Over the last 10 years Owen Lean has become one of the world’s most successful street magicians, receiving the world’s first street magic degree in 2006 and being heralded for ‘carrying the flag of great British street performers’ by Gazzo. When Owen first started performing on the streets he crafted his own style of performance that came to be known as Hit and Run magic. This style, similar to the style seen by television magicians such as David Blaine, Paul Zenon and Criss Angel – involved performing close-up magic on the streets and making a quick bit of money before moving on. In this lecture Owen will outline how 'Hit and Run' magic works, teach how you can get out and make a living doing this kind of magic immediately, and teach some of the effects he used to blow people’s minds while performing.
